struct _PEP_WORK_INFORMATION// Size=0x40
{
    enum _PEP_WORK_TYPE WorkType;// Offset=0x0 Size=0x4
    struct _PEP_WORK_ACTIVE_COMPLETE ActiveComplete;// Offset=0x8 Size=0x10
    struct _PEP_WORK_IDLE_STATE IdleState;// Offset=0x8 Size=0x10
    struct _PEP_WORK_DEVICE_POWER DevicePower;// Offset=0x8 Size=0x10
    struct _PEP_WORK_POWER_CONTROL PowerControl;// Offset=0x8 Size=0x38
    struct _PEP_WORK_DEVICE_IDLE DeviceIdle;// Offset=0x8 Size=0x10
    struct _PEP_WORK_COMPLETE_IDLE_STATE CompleteIdleState;// Offset=0x8 Size=0x10
    struct _PEP_WORK_COMPLETE_PERF_STATE CompletePerfState;// Offset=0x8 Size=0x10
    struct _PEP_WORK_ACPI_NOTIFY AcpiNotify;// Offset=0x8 Size=0x10
    struct _PEP_WORK_ACPI_EVALUATE_CONTROL_METHOD_COMPLETE ControlMethodComplete;// Offset=0x8 Size=0x28
};